news 2026/4/18 10:02:17

OpenCode终极指南:免费开源的AI编程助手快速入门

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
OpenCode终极指南:免费开源的AI编程助手快速入门

OpenCode终极指南:免费开源的AI编程助手快速入门

【免费下载链接】opencode一个专为终端打造的开源AI编程助手,模型灵活可选,可远程驱动。项目地址: https://gitcode.com/GitHub_Trending/openc/opencode

还在为复杂的AI编程工具配置而头疼?OpenCode作为一款专为终端设计的开源AI编程助手,真正实现了"即装即用"的便捷体验。无论你是编程新手还是资深开发者,这款工具都能在5分钟内帮你完成安装配置,即刻开启高效AI编程之旅。

🚀 快速安装:三种方式任你选

一键脚本安装(推荐所有用户)

curl -fsSL https://opencode.ai/install | bash

包管理器安装

# npm用户 npm i -g opencode-ai@latest # macOS和Linux用户 brew install anomalyco/tap/opencode # Windows用户 scoop bucket add extras; scoop install extras/opencode

桌面应用版本

OpenCode还提供桌面应用版本,支持macOS、Windows和Linux系统,可从官网直接下载安装包。

🎯 核心功能深度解析

智能代码编辑助手

OpenCode在终端中提供直观的AI编程界面,你可以:

  • 使用自然语言与AI助手直接对话
  • 实时查看代码修改建议和详细对比
  • 快速采纳或拒绝AI生成的代码变更
  • 在熟悉的命令行环境中享受AI编程的便利

VS Code无缝集成体验

VS Code扩展提供了更丰富的功能:

  • 侧边栏AI助手对话窗口
  • 代码行级别的精确修改对比
  • 编辑器内直接执行AI指令
  • 与现有开发环境完美融合

🔧 实用配置技巧大全

自定义AI模型选择

OpenCode支持多种主流AI模型,让你根据需求灵活切换:

  • Anthropic Claude系列(Claude 3.5 Sonnet等)
  • OpenAI GPT系列(GPT-4o等)
  • Google Gemini系列
  • 本地部署的模型

环境变量配置

在项目根目录的配置文件中设置关键参数:

OPENCODE_API_KEY=your_api_key OPENCODE_MODEL=claude-3-5-sonnet-latest

💡 高效使用场景实战

代码调试与问题定位

当遇到代码错误时,只需简单描述:"我的函数报错了,帮我分析一下原因",AI助手会快速定位问题并提供详细的修复方案。

功能实现加速器

需要快速实现特定功能?告诉AI:"我需要一个用户注册验证函数",它会生成完整的代码框架和实现逻辑。

代码优化与重构专家

面对性能瓶颈或代码质量问题,请求:"帮我重构这个组件,提升性能",AI会提供专业的优化建议和重构方案。

🛠️ 进阶配置与扩展

插件系统深度探索

通过OpenCode的插件系统,你可以扩展自定义功能,满足特定的开发需求。

客户端/服务器架构优势

OpenCode采用独特的客户端/服务器架构设计,这意味着:

  • 可以在本地计算机上运行OpenCode
  • 通过移动应用远程控制AI编程助手
  • TUI前端只是众多可能的客户端之一

❓ 常见问题快速解决

安装问题处理

问题:命令未找到?解决方案:重启终端或手动添加环境变量到配置文件中。

问题:响应速度慢?
优化建议:尝试切换不同的AI模型或检查网络连接质量。

升级与维护指南

升级命令:

brew upgrade opencode # 或 npm update -g opencode-ai

卸载命令:

brew uninstall opencode # 或 npm uninstall -g opencode-ai

📊 使用效果与优势评估

经过实际测试和使用反馈,OpenCode展现出三大核心优势:

  • 安装极简:真正的一键式部署体验
  • 交互自然:无需学习复杂命令语法
  • 功能全面:从简单代码修改到复杂算法实现

🎉 开启你的AI编程新篇章

现在,打开终端,输入opencode命令,立即体验AI编程的魅力!从代码调试到功能实现,从性能优化到架构设计,OpenCode都能成为你的得力编程助手。

记住:优秀的工具应该让复杂的事情变得简单,而OpenCode正是这样的存在。开始使用,让编程效率实现质的飞跃!🚀

【免费下载链接】opencode一个专为终端打造的开源AI编程助手,模型灵活可选,可远程驱动。项目地址: https://gitcode.com/GitHub_Trending/openc/opencode

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/17 23:45:43

NewBie-image-Exp0.1部署教程:基于Docker的GPU容器化运行方案

NewBie-image-Exp0.1部署教程:基于Docker的GPU容器化运行方案 1. 引言 随着生成式AI在动漫图像创作领域的快速发展,高质量、易用性强的预训练模型成为研究者和创作者的重要工具。NewBie-image-Exp0.1 是一个专注于高保真动漫图像生成的大规模扩散模型&…

作者头像 李华
网站建设 2026/4/18 3:49:32

开发者必看:通义千问3-4B-Instruct镜像免配置快速上手

开发者必看:通义千问3-4B-Instruct镜像免配置快速上手 1. 引言 随着大模型向端侧部署的不断推进,轻量化、高性能的小参数模型正成为开发者构建本地AI应用的核心选择。通义千问 3-4B-Instruct-2507(Qwen3-4B-Instruct-2507)是阿里…

作者头像 李华
网站建设 2026/4/18 3:51:41

XiaoMusic深度技术解析:如何用Python构建智能音箱音乐播放系统

XiaoMusic深度技术解析:如何用Python构建智能音箱音乐播放系统 【免费下载链接】xiaomusic 使用小爱同学播放音乐,音乐使用 yt-dlp 下载。 项目地址: https://gitcode.com/GitHub_Trending/xia/xiaomusic XiaoMusic是一款基于Python开发的智能音箱…

作者头像 李华
网站建设 2026/4/18 3:26:56

MinerU与Qwen-VL对比评测:学术论文解析谁更准?

MinerU与Qwen-VL对比评测:学术论文解析谁更准? 1. 选型背景与评测目标 在当前AI驱动的智能文档处理领域,如何高效、精准地从复杂学术论文中提取结构化信息成为研究者和工程人员关注的核心问题。随着多模态大模型的发展,视觉-语言…

作者头像 李华
网站建设 2026/4/18 3:49:27

FRCRN语音降噪模型快速上手:5分钟完成单麦16k环境配置

FRCRN语音降噪模型快速上手:5分钟完成单麦16k环境配置 1. 引言 1.1 业务场景描述 在实际语音交互系统中,如智能音箱、会议系统和语音助手,单通道麦克风采集的音频常受到环境噪声干扰,严重影响后续的语音识别(ASR&am…

作者头像 李华
网站建设 2026/4/18 3:48:16

MinerU 2.5部署案例:企业文档数字化处理流水线

MinerU 2.5部署案例:企业文档数字化处理流水线 1. 背景与挑战 在企业级知识管理、智能搜索和自动化文档处理场景中,PDF 文档的结构化提取一直是一个关键但极具挑战的技术环节。传统 OCR 工具在面对多栏排版、复杂表格、数学公式和图文混排时&#xff0…

作者头像 李华